Healthy Eats: Wabi Sabi

I would like to introduce to you one of my favorite vegetarian restaurants in Manila. Wabi Sabi is conveniently across the studio where I teach Yin Yoga 9am Thursday mornings and a short drive from my son's school, too!


When I am craving for Japanese flavor, I frequent this place for take out or have mini-dates with my son. They're known for their ramen. Vegetarian ramen? Yes!


Their menu is really affordable, too!


Seating capacity is only at about 12 so I suggest heading here right before it hits 12noon for lunch or non-peak hours. They are closed Mondays (I had to learn this that the hard way)!


They are known for their ramon but here's what I always order: The Okonomigyoza (75php) and their Chahan Fried Rice (75php)

The Vegetarian Kitchen

Not too far from Beyond Yoga Il Terrazo studio is a little nook called The Vegetarian Kitchen, a cruel-free restaurant that is operated by the Soliongco family.

My first time dining here was with FLOW co-founders, Denise and Noelle. We got to try the Rich Tomato Malunggay Lasagna, Cream Cheese Spinach Dumplings, Couscous Paella, Vegan Apple Pie and Calamansi Mint Tea. Everything was superb! If I could cook and bake like they do, I'm sure my husband wouldn't mind turning vegetarian :P
